cplinux
1. linux中cp的用法
我記得 cp 不支持這么弄的。
你有兩個選擇:
1、目標機開 sshd 服務,之後用 scp 命令拷貝。當然 ftp 也可以。
2、網路掛載目標機提供的網路磁碟掛載。nfs 和 samba 都支持這么弄。
samba 服務好像 cp 不支持直接遠程使用。而且,藉助 samba 好像需要 url 前綴 smb:// 才行。但這個介面好像命令行沒有幾個軟體支持?
2. LINUX命令的cp -r 和-R的區別是
cp -r 的作用是遞歸,可復制目錄,如果復制目錄必須加此選項。
cp -R的作用僅僅是復制目錄。
不過cp -r 和-R命令功能上是等價的。不加-r或者-R的時候,只輸入命令cp時只拷貝文件,不拷貝文件夾,加上後則會拷貝文件夾——包括下一級的子文件夾,以及子文件夾中的子文件夾,以此類推。
(2)cplinux擴展閱讀:
cp命令還有以下幾種用法:
cp -p可以保留許可權、屬主、時間戳。
cp -d作用為默認鏈接文件是復制鏈接指向的源文件,-d 復制鏈接文件本身。
cp -L作用為保存鏈接所指向的文件,默認cp 就是,不需要-L。
cp -a作用為歸檔復制,常用於備份,相當於cp -dr --preserve=all。
cp -v作用為復制過程可見。
cp -s 作用為創建新的符號鏈接文件,指向原符號鏈接文件,能保證鏈接文件可以使用
cp -u作用為只復制更新的文件
3. linux cp命令
貌似不會有什麼後果,跟cp -R /var/log/* 是一個效果, 但是log是個文件,所以直接復制過去了
4. linux中在復制一個目錄時cp -a 和cp -r有什麼區別
cp文件時候可以不用加參數,但是cp文件夾的時候必須加-R或-r,操作方法如下:
1、首先打開linux,使用cp的命令格式
5. linux中cp命令的用法
我在「銀河麒麟」操作系統下測試了一下,命令是
cp *.* /aaa
後面必須打/目錄名,在LINUX下/代表跟目錄,然後跟具體路徑就可以了
6. 關於linux裡面cp的用法
lianxi這個目錄在哪兒?如果在home下面的話, 就試試看
cp /home/lianxi/io/io.c SUM
或者
cp ~/io/io.c SUM
或者進入到有io目錄的目錄試試
cp ./io/io.c SUM
7. linux cp指令
cp ~/tianqi/igfbp/0.aa .
最後加個點號表示復制到當前路徑即可,這是相對路徑的寫法。
cp命令後面必須要跟兩個參數,一個表示源文件路徑,另一個表示目標路徑(可以是目錄路徑,也可以是文件路徑)
8. linux 下cp的用法
cp /var/a.text /user/lib
cp 拷貝時加的是目的路徑,而不是文件名字
mv 是移動的命令:
mv /var/a.text /user/lib
mv後面可以加路徑也可以加文件名字
加路徑時是移動,加名字時是重命名
9. Linux cp命令使用
cd /home/public/pro1011/androidfor i in `ls -al |grep -v ".svn"`do cp -r $i /home/cx/pro1011/androiddone
10. Linux下cp和scp的詳細說明及其他們的區別
一、說明
cp:是在同一個linux系統上,在不同的目錄之間復制文件;
scp:是在不同linux系統之間來回復制文件;
二、cp 用法
單個文件復制:
cp 源文件 目標路徑 ~~從原路徑復制源文件到目標路徑下;如果在目標路勁之後加文件名稱和格式意思就是復制過去之後將該文件重命名。
多個文件復制:
cp 源文件1 源文件2 源文件3 ... 目標路徑 ~~從原路徑復制源文件到目標路徑下;
三、cp 的參數詳解
-a 盡可能將源文件狀態、許可權等資料都照原裝予以復制,並且是遞歸;
-r 表示遞歸,若source中含有目錄名,則將目錄下之檔案亦皆依序拷貝至目的地;
-f 若目的地已經有相同檔名的檔案存在,則在復制前先予以刪除再行復制;
四、scp 的用法
基本語法:scp [參數] 文件 @IP:/目標路徑;如下圖
五、scp參數詳解
-1 強制scp命令使用協議ssh1
-2 強制scp命令使用協議ssh2
-4 強制scp命令只使用IPv4定址
-6 強制scp命令只使用IPv6定址
-B 使用批處理模式(傳輸過程中不詢問傳輸口令或短語)
-C 允許壓縮。(將-C標志傳遞給ssh,從而打開壓縮功能)
-p 保留原文件的修改時間,訪問時間和訪問許可權。
-q 不顯示傳輸進度條。
-r 遞歸復制整個目錄。
-v 詳細方式顯示輸出。scp和ssh(1)會顯示出整個過程的調試信息。這些信息用於調試連接,驗證和配置問題。
-c cipher 以cipher將數據傳輸進行加密,這個選項將直接傳遞給ssh。
-F ssh_config 指定一個替代的ssh配置文件,此參數直接傳遞給ssh。
-i identity_file 從指定文件中讀取傳輸時使用的密鑰文件,此參數直接傳遞給ssh。
-l limit 限定用戶所能使用的帶寬,以Kbit/s為單位。
-o ssh_option 如果習慣於使用ssh_config(5)中的參數傳遞方式,
-P port 注意是大寫的P, port是指定數據傳輸用到的埠號
-S program 指定加密傳輸時所使用的程序。此程序必須能夠理解ssh(1)的選項。
例:scp -r 文件夾 @IP:目標路徑;